God's Grace
- For forgiveness of sin (Roman 3:24)
Being justified freely by His grace through the redemption that is in Christ Jesus:
Through the grace of God, we are given a privilege to live with Him forever. No one can boast of anything,because we deserved eternal separation from God. By His grace, we are called the children of the Most High.
- For the work of the ministry (I Cor 15:9-11)
For I am the least of the apostles, that am not meet to be called an apostle, because I persecuted the Church of God. But by the grace of God I am what I am: and his grace which was bestowed upon me was not in vain; but I laboured more abundantly than they all: yet not I, but the grace of God which was with me. Therefore whether it were I or they, so we preach; and so ye believed. We ought to understand that we can never minister for God by our own strength. Ministering for God is not an easy thing as someone may think. It takes graces for you and me to continue ministering for Him. Every one of us should ask for God's grace to do the works of God.
- For the solution of our need (Heb 4:16)
Let us therefore come boldly unto the throne of grace, that we may obtain mercy, and find grace to help in time of need.
The need that you have, it is by the grace of God that it is met. Do you have a need? The solution to your need can be found by presenting your circumstance to the mercy seat and the grace you find there will be enough for you and me to get through.
- For our restoration (Ps 137:1-5)
By the rivers of Babylon, there we sat down, yea, we wept, when we remembered Zion. We hanged our harps upon the willows in the midst thereof. For there they that carried us away captive required of us a song; and they that wasted us required of us mirth, saying, Sing us one of the songs of Zion. How shall we sing the Lord's song in a strange land? If I forget thee, O Jerusalem, let my right hand forget her cunning.
God is in the business of restoring his people. Isn't God so good?
